What is the HSL value of #eed4cf?

In the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#eed4cf has an HSL value of 10° (degrees) for Hue, 48% for Saturation, and 87% for Lightness. In this HSL representation, the Hue at 10° indicates the basic color tone, which is a shade of red in this case. The Saturation value of 48% describes the intensity or purity of this color, with a higher percentage indicating a more vivid and pure color. The Lightness value of 87% determines the brightness of the color, where a higher percentage represents a lighter shade. Together, these HSL values combine to create the distinctive shade of red that is both moderately vivid and fairly bright, as indicated by the specific values for this color. The HSL color model is particularly useful in digital arts and web design, as it allows for easy adjustments of color tones, saturation, and brightness levels.
